Windcrest is a city of 5,400 residents. It is located in Bexar County, Texas, and is less than 30 minutes from San Antonio. The median income for families living in the city is $69,200, and most residents make the commute to nearby San Antonio for work.
Windcrest is serviced by the North East Independent School District, also known as NEISD. Students who live in the city attend Roosevelt High School, which is located in neighboring San Antonio. This high school is known for its two excellent magnet programs, the Design and Technology Academy and the Engineering & Technologies Academy. It has also been awarded National Blue Ribbon status by the U.S. Department of Education. Windcrest is a quiet community, so there aren't many areas of entertainment in the area. It is home to the Windcrest Light Up festival, an annual Christmas festival where members of the community compete to see who has the best holiday decorations. If you are interested in entertainment throughout the year, you can visit San Antonio. There, you can watch a San Antonio Spurs basketball game at the AT&T Center or spend the day riding roller coasters at Six Flags Fiesta Texas.
